Fort Worth Hospital

by Michelle Baugh

Hospitals in the Fort Worth area belong to a non-profit association known as the Dallas-Fort Worth Hospital Council (DFWHC), an organization which aims to constantly improve the quality of health care in Fort Worth and its surrounding areas. In order to be allowed membership into the organization, members must be licensed by and be in good standing with the State of Texas.

For 37 years, the DFWCH has strived to improve the conditions at hospitals and healthcare businesses in the Fort Worth area. The organization, which is comprised of members from hospitals and healthcare organizations, is controlled by a Board of Trustees, made up of 11 leaders from member hospitals, namely the Chief Executive Officers and/or Chief Operating Officers of the hospitals.

Fort Worth itself has an array of hospitals to choose from. One of the more prominent hospitals is Harris Methodist Hospital, which now has six facilities across Texas. The flagship hospital, located in Fort Worth, opened in 1930. The hospital provides many services, from day surgery to long-term physical therapy.

There are some important things to consider when choosing a hospital in the Fort Worth area. One thing to look at is whether the hospital mission statement is compatible with the patient. This is especially important when looking at a hospital that may have religious ties that could present a conflict to personal beliefs. Additionally, certain medical plans may have restrictions on which hospitals, or even possibly which doctors associated with the hospital, can be visited. As with most major decisions, it is always best to weigh each option to discover what will work best for the individual.
